如何批量修改excel中的超链接

我的excel的I列中的超链接为:法律\*.doc我想批量修改为:档案馆\法律\*.doc如何修改?我批量替换是不可以的... 我的excel的I列中的超链接为:法律\*.doc 我想批量修改为:档案馆\法律\*.doc 如何修改?我批量替换是不可以的 展开
 我来答
调广实0I
2009-03-20 · TA获得超过2568个赞
知道小有建树答主
回答量:673
采纳率:0%
帮助的人:563万
展开全部
环境:Excel2003,超链接是通过在单元格上右击选择“超链接”而产生的超链接;
注意:这种超链接是无法通过excel的查找功能查找具体的超链接路径的,也就无法用查找替换来批量修改超链接路径了;
下面介绍一种方法:

点击菜单,工具→宏→Microsoft 脚本编辑器,是不是发现从这里可以看到超链接的具体路径呢!
现在好办事了,用查找替换的方法快速修改超链接路径,修改完后,点击菜单,文件→将所选项目存为...→保存为一个html文件,完成后,再用excel打开该html文件,最后重新保存该文件为"microsoft office excel工作簿"文件。

这样就OK了!

也许你会问,为什么不在"Microsoft 脚本编辑器"中直接保存,这个你自己实践一下就知道了
智者总要千虑
高粉答主

推荐于2016-07-06 · 说的都是干货,快来关注
知道顶级答主
回答量:7.9万
采纳率:88%
帮助的人:1.4亿
展开全部

1.如图所示,新建一个Excel,输入数据;

    ↓

2.选择“插入”选项卡,点击“链接”选项的“超链接”插入链接文档。

3.当仅移动文件或是插入文档的位置时,会弹出“无法打开指定的文件”的提示框,这时就需要修改链接地址。

4.选择“开发工具”选项卡,点击“代码”选项的“宏安全性”;

    ↓

5.弹出“信任中心”窗口;

    ↓

6.在“信任中心”窗口中,选择“宏设置”选项卡→点击“宏设置”选项中的“启用所有宏”单选项→点击“确定”。

7.回到Excel中,选择“开发工具”选项卡,点击“控件”选项的“查看代码”;

    ↓

8.弹出Excel的VB窗口“Microsoft Visual Basic - 新建 Microsoft Office Excel 工作表”;

    ↓

9.在VB窗口中,选择需修改超链接的Sheet页;

    ↓

10.在Sheet1(代码)窗口中,输入下列代码:

    Sub ChangeHyperlink()

        For Each c In ActiveSheet.Hyperlinks

             c.Address = Replace(c.Address, "新建文件夹\", "F:\ZHOUMIN\操  作文档\Excel\新建文件夹\")

        Next

    End Sub

说明:如图所示,代码中,第一个引号的内容为超链接的原始路径,第二个引号的内容为现在的路径。

    ↓

关闭VB窗口。


11.回到Excel中,选择“开发工具”选项卡,点击“代码”选项的“宏”;

    ↓

12.弹出“宏”设置窗口;

   ↓

13.在宏名中输入“Sheet名.方法名”,如“Sheet1.ChangeHyperlink”;

   ↓

14.点击“执行”。


15.关闭“宏”设置窗口,回到Excel中,随意打开一个超链接,能成功打开链接文档,则超链接修改成功。

16.因为设置了宏,所有在保存或关闭Excel的时候,会弹出隐私问题警告提示框,如图所示;

    ↓

17.为了让提示框不在弹出,可以进入“开发工具”选项卡,点击“代码”选项的“宏”,选中宏名,点击删除即可。

    ↓

18.关闭Excel,重新打开,就不会再弹出提示框了。

已赞过 已踩过<
你对这个回答的评价是?
评论 收起
百度网友2616bb5d0
2009-03-31 · 超过10用户采纳过TA的回答
知道答主
回答量:28
采纳率:0%
帮助的人:0
展开全部
直接查找替换不能批量修改,我试过,我也在找答案呢,我看有些人用 HYPERLINK 函数,你也试试看。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
匿名用户
2018-10-03
展开全部

EXCEL必备工具箱免费版,可以批量添加或者删除超链接:

已赞过 已踩过<
你对这个回答的评价是?
评论 收起
HyperStar
2009-03-20 · 超过17用户采纳过TA的回答
知道答主
回答量:143
采纳率:0%
帮助的人:55.2万
展开全部
没错,替换很简单,
将法律替换为档案馆\法律即可,需要注意的是确保其他地方没有法律关键字
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(4)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式